Output 891084fd3f2702574fcafe29e5155355f305d511ffb3973cb5a66cdc646a4de2:60

value
887894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d82823b96a3761b7cbb264ad109b66d7150feed8 OP_EQUAL
address
3MPwxvXx56Yp5h5BhbGeqoKgf9uwzet1HA
transaction
891084fd3f2702574fcafe29e5155355f305d511ffb3973cb5a66cdc646a4de2
spent
true